Abstract

669,001. Refrigerators. BRITISH THOMSON-HOUSTON CO., Ltd. May 16, 1950 [May 25, 1949], No. 12205/50. Class 29. In a refrigerator cooled by the evaporator 8 of a compression system, the cold air from which flows through passage 19 between a horizontal baffle 13 and the rear wall of the cabinet, a hinged damper 20 in the passage is controlled by a solenoid 27 so as to be closed when the compressor is inoperative and open when the compressor is operative. In Fig. 2, the solenoid 27 and the compressor motor are energized simultaneously by a thermal element 34 in contact with the evaporator. When the compressor stops, the damper 20 closes by gravity. In a modification the damper is closed by the solenoid when the compressorstops and is opened by gravity when the compressor starts. The evaporator 8 has a front door 10 condensation from which drops into a channel 12. The baffle 13 serves as a drip tray.
